前后分离架构逐渐成为现代Web开发的主流趋势。这种架构使得前端和后端开发更加独立,提高了开发效率和代码质量。在前后端分离的过程中,如何确保搜索引擎优化(SEO)效果,成为许多开发者关注的焦点。本文将探讨前后端分离与SEO优化之间的关系,并提供一些建议,以帮助开发者构建高效搜索引擎排名的桥梁。

一、前后端分离对SEO的影响

前后端分离与SEO优化,构建高效搜索引擎排名的桥梁  第1张

1. 代码结构优化

前后端分离架构使得前端和后端代码结构更加清晰,有利于搜索引擎更好地解析页面内容。通过将静态资源(如HTML、CSS、JavaScript)与动态内容(如服务器数据)分离,有利于搜索引擎抓取和索引页面。

2. 页面加载速度提升

前后端分离可以降低页面加载时间,提高用户体验。搜索引擎算法越来越注重页面加载速度,快速加载的页面更有可能获得更高的排名。

3. 内容更新频率提高

前后端分离使得内容更新更加便捷,有利于搜索引擎抓取最新内容。频繁更新的内容更容易获得搜索引擎的青睐。

4. SEO策略调整

前后端分离对SEO策略提出了一定的挑战,如URL优化、关键词布局等。开发者需要重新审视和调整SEO策略,以适应前后端分离架构。

二、前后端分离下的SEO优化策略

1. URL优化

在前后端分离架构中,URL结构对于SEO至关重要。以下是一些建议:

(1)使用简洁明了的URL路径,避免使用特殊字符和参数。

(2)遵循搜索引擎推荐的标准URL结构,如采用小写字母、下划线等。

(3)利用URL参数传递动态内容,确保参数对搜索引擎友好。

2. 关键词布局

前后端分离对关键词布局提出了一定的要求。以下是一些建议:

(1)在HTML页面中合理布局关键词,如标题、描述、正文等。

(2)利用前端技术实现关键词的动态插入,提高关键词密度。

(3)关注长尾关键词的布局,提高页面收录数量。

3. 静态资源优化

静态资源优化对于前后端分离架构至关重要。以下是一些建议:

(1)压缩CSS、JavaScript和HTML文件,减少文件大小。

(2)利用浏览器缓存技术,提高页面加载速度。

(3)合理设置HTTP缓存策略,确保内容更新后及时更新缓存。

4. 网站地图与robots.txt

(1)创建网站地图,帮助搜索引擎更好地抓取页面。

(2)合理设置robots.txt文件,确保搜索引擎可以正常访问网站。

随着前后端分离架构的普及,SEO优化成为开发者关注的焦点。通过以上策略,可以在前后端分离架构下实现高效的SEO优化。SEO优化是一个持续的过程,开发者需要不断学习和调整策略,以适应搜索引擎算法的变化。

参考文献:

[1] 张三. 前后端分离与SEO优化[J]. 计算机技术与发展,2018,28(6):1-5.

[2] 李四. 基于前后端分离的Web应用SEO优化策略研究[J]. 计算机与现代化,2019,35(5):1-4.

[3] 王五. 前后端分离架构下的SEO优化策略探讨[J]. 计算机技术与发展,2017,27(12):1-4.